Founder Of Gimme Seaweed, Annie Chun, Receives Prestigious Award From Korean Government For Contributions To Seafood Exports


(MENAFN- PR Newswire) The Korean seaweed industry has demonstrated dramatic growth topping $1B in exports in 2024, with the US now their number one export market. This award signifies the Korean Government's recognition of Gimme as a foreign company leading the charge in making this ultra-sustainable and nutritious crop an international success.

After selling her multimillion-dollar namesake company, Annie Chun's, Annie delved into the snack category in 2012 on a mission to adapt a traditional Korean side dish to a healthy snack in flavors that would entice American palates. Gimme became the first, and at the time only, brand to offer USDA Certified/Non-GMO Verified Organic seaweed snacks, and Annie successfully influenced South Korean farmers to change their practices to make this possible.

Whether inspiring the Korean government to develop a strategic marketing campaign like an "Avocados from Mexico" style initiative for Korean seaweed or traveling to meet directly with the Governor of Jeollanam-do Province-where 80-90% of Korean seaweed is cultivated, Annie has been a driving force in cultivating relationships between the US and Korean industries and putting Korean seaweed on the map globally.

Since the brand's inception, Annie has ensured that Gimme's seaweed is sustainably grown and incorporates the highest quality ingredients. Today Gimme is by far the leading seaweed brand in the US, driving the growth of the whole category.
